Hosts New Zealand will kick off the 2022 Women’s ODI World Cup on March 4 against a qualifier in Tauranga, with eight of the best teams in women’s cricket battling it out in 31 matches in 31 days across six cities. Defending champions England will start. their summit match against Australia on March 5 in Hamilton. And India, the 2017 runners-up, will also hope to be better than them, starting with the qualifiers on March 6. Although New Zealand, Australia, England, South Africa and India have qualified, the third qualification will come from a single tournament to be held in Sri Lanka from June 26 to July 10, 2021. In keeping with the format of the Cup itself of the World, the tag All eight teams will face each other once and the top four will advance to the final. Wellington will host the first semi-final on March 30 and Christchurch will host the second and final semi-final on March 31 and April 3. All three games will have reserved dates. Auckland and Dunedin are the remaining two of the six venues that were retained from the original 2021 schedule. Auckland will also host a huge second weekend, with India taking on Australia on March 19, and New Zealand taking on England the following day. . Friday! It’s been five years since England won the 2017 title on home soil, but after a 12-month delay due to COVID-19, the ODI World Cup will begin in earnest when hosts New Zealand play the West Indies in Tauranga , on Friday. .
There will be 31 games played over 31 days, culminating in the final at Christchurch’s Hagley Oval on April 3.

The World Cup was organized in six New Zealand cities: Auckland, Wellington, Hamilton, Tauranga, Dunedin and Christchurch.

Hosts New Zealand are eligible, as are Australia, England, India and South Africa based on their success in the ICC Women’s ODI Championship. West Indies, Pakistan and Bangladesh confirmed their places thanks to their ODI rankings when the world qualifying tournament in Zimbabwe last December was canceled due to COVID-19.
The biggest disappointment is that of Sri Lanka, who failed to perform well after having participated on the previous six occasions.

Each team will play the other once during the round robin phase of the tournament. The top four teams will advance to the finals on March 30th and 31st, before the final on April 3rd.

Australia will be favorites to win their seventh title. They now have a 40-point lead at the top of the ICC ODI rankings and have lost just two of the 30 one-day games they have played since the 2017 World Cup final, a period that includes their record run of 26 consecutive victories.
However, they will face stiff competition from defending champions England, hosts New Zealand, 2017 runners-up India and world runners-up South Africa.

In 2017, Heather Knight’s England won the title at Lord’s after defending a score of 7-228 to deny India their maiden title.

Australia were knocked out of the semi-finals after a superb 171 from Harmanpreet Kaur took India to the final, while England progressed after a semi-final exit against South Africa.
The game could go ahead with just nine players in the squad as organizers look to keep the tournament going despite the rising number of COVID-19 cases in New Zealand.
The ICC has confirmed that women in the team’s support team will be able to play in the tournament during the pandemic, with games being played for as long as possible. The team has a minimum of nine players.
Meanwhile, the winner will receive US$1.32 million (A$1.85 million), while the competition’s total prize money is US$3.5 million.
